WebJun 23, 2024 · The TR1 form is a legally binding document that transfers the whole ownership of a property from one party to another. It can also be used to transfer an unregistered property to be registered with Land Registry. The transfer will then be registered at the Land Registry and noted on the Official Copy Entries. earth\u0027s tilt and orbit around the sunWebJul 29, 2024 · You should use form AS1 to assent, ie transfer, the whole of one or more registered titles to the beneficiary or beneficiaries. If you use this form, the ownership will change for all the land and property in the title. You can only transfer the whole of the legal ownership and we then register that change so if you transfer to just the widow or the widow and children we register the outcome, nit how you arrived at it. earth\u0027s tilt angleWebJan 13, 2024 · Security, speed, affordability: the benefits of lodging certified copies with first registrations. Sending certified copies of deeds with first registration applications is faster, more secure and less costly than lodging original documents.
